Dream Boy is a 2008 gay-themed Southern Gothic drama film written and directed by James Bolton, and based on Jim Grimsley's 1995 novel of the same name. It follows two gay teenagers falling in love in the rural South in the late 1970s.
Dream Boy or Dream Boys (abbreviated as Doribo) [1] is a Japanese musical production. It features many performers from Johnny & Associates and was first performed in January 2004 as Magical Musical Dream Boy [ 2 ] starring Hideaki Takizawa , and has been performed again with repeated cast and content changes. Richard and Judy Book Club display at W.H. Smith, Enfield. The following is a list of books from the Richard & Judy Book Club, featured on the television chat show. The show was cancelled in 2009, but since 2010 the lists have been continued by the Richard and Judy Book Club, a website run in conjunction with retailer W. H. Smith.
